The series follows the daily routine of a medical team working under intense pressure in a busy Pennsylvania hospital. Enduring exhausting 15-hour shifts, these professionals deal not only with complex medical cases but also with personal and ethical dilemmas that put their convictions to the test.
At the heart of the story is Dr. Ethan Harrington (Noah Wyle), a veteran doctor trying to balance his professional and personal life while training new residents. Alongside him, Dr. Lillian Brooks (Tracy Ifeachor) and young surgeon Dr. Nate Reynolds (Patrick Ball) face challenging situations where every decision could mean the difference between life and death.

Trivia
- From the creators of major hits: The Pitt was created by John Wells (known for Burnt) and R. Scott Gemmill (writer of Jonny Zero and NCIS: Los Angeles), two experienced names in crafting intense and realistic dramas.
- Veteran lead actor: Noah Wyle, famous for his role in ER, returns to the medical drama genre with a character who embodies experience, exhaustion, and empathy.
- Talented cast: The series features standout performances from:
- Noah Wyle (ER) as Dr. Ethan Harrington
- Tracy Ifeachor (Showtrial) as Dr. Lillian Brooks
- Patrick Ball (Horse Camp) as Dr. Nate Reynolds

- Reality-inspired plot: The showrunner revealed that the series was based on real accounts from doctors working long shifts, bringing an impressive level of authenticity to the narrative.
- Immersive filming: To make the hospital scenes as realistic as possible, the actors underwent intensive medical training, and some sequences were filmed in decommissioned hospitals.
Critical Reception
Since its premiere, The Pitt has received high praise for its gripping storyline and the outstanding performances of its cast. The series has earned 92% approval on Rotten Tomatoes, standing out for its raw and realistic portrayal of the hospital environment. On IMDb, it holds a solid rating of 8.2/10, reflecting the positive audience reception.
Critics highlight that the series offers a harsher, more visceral perspective on medical life, steering away from the common clichés of the genre. Additionally, the moral dilemmas faced by the characters add an extra layer of depth to the narrative.
